How to Find the VIN on a BMW 428i
The VIN is usually visible in several places on the vehicle.
On most BMW 4 Series models, you can find it on the dashboard near the base of the windshield on the driver’s side.
It also appears on the driver’s door jamb, registration documents, insurance paperwork, and the title.
Before using any decoder, make sure the VIN is copied exactly.
A single incorrect character can produce the wrong build sheet or a failed lookup.
Avoid confusing similar characters such as 0 and O, or 1 and I, although VINs do not use the letters I, O, or Q.

Key BMW 428i Specs You Can Verify
Engine and drivetrain?
The BMW 428i is commonly associated with BMW’s 2.0-liter turbocharged four-cylinder engine from the N20 family in many markets and model years.
A proper VIN decoder can help confirm the engine code and whether the car is equipped with rear-wheel drive or xDrive all-wheel drive.
This is important for maintenance planning because engine-specific components, fluids, and service intervals may differ from those used on other 4 Series trims.
It also helps you confirm parts compatibility before ordering items such as ignition coils, filters, sensors, or turbo-related components.
Body style and transmission?
The 428i was offered in more than one body style depending on market and year.
A decoder can identify whether the VIN corresponds to a coupe, convertible, or Gran Coupe configuration.
It can also confirm the transmission type, such as an automatic gearbox or manual transmission where applicable.
These details matter when searching for replacement parts, wheels, suspension components, and interior trim, because BMW often used different parts across body styles even within the same model family.

What the VIN Cannot Tell You
A decoder is powerful, but it does not replace a vehicle inspection or maintenance history review.
The VIN generally cannot confirm current mechanical condition, accident history, odometer accuracy, aftermarket modifications, or whether the car has been properly serviced.
It is also important to understand that some decoders show more data than others.
One service may provide a basic model summary, while another can display a more complete BMW build sheet or option list.
If the result seems incomplete, try a second source or compare it with the BMW window sticker, service records, or dealer documentation.

BMW 428i VIN Decoder and Parts Ordering
For maintenance and repair work, VIN decoding is one of the best ways to reduce parts mistakes.
BMW frequently revised components across production runs, so a part that fits one 428i may not fit another built in a different month or factory configuration.
Using the VIN helps you confirm:
- Correct engine-related parts
- Brake and suspension compatibility
- Interior trim and electronic module versions
- Wheel offset and tire specifications
- Factory-installed technology packages
This is especially useful when ordering from OEM parts catalogs, independent BMW specialists, or online retailers that require precise fitment data.
